It would be on. just to say there are not medal and valuable fields to labor in, yet •national association like We, should if, possible deviere more comprehensive reforms, and take the lead in metisetrea which would so remould society 94 to lift these dependent classes out of their condition of dependence/ Somo gratifying fasts is regard to the operation of awelioratire laws were reported by Mr. Baker in ." one of the sections, who stated that since the passage - , of the °Factory Act," redacing the hears of labor, there had been' a marked and Measly. improvdmeta • in the health of factory operatives, and an entire dis appearance of the physical deformity and excessive ' mortality which prevailed among those classes pre viously. In the condition now brought about by that act:there was no greater amount of disease, deform oity or mortality among factory laborer; than others, while for some years previous to 1952, a marked and alarming deterioration of physical strength had ea vaned. FaTILAORDI9AILY ADUILISIOSB.—WO publish this morning a vary remarkable article from the Richmond Enquirer, elicited by the recent out• break at Harper's Ferry. It makes that affair the occasion for reinforcing the okra demands of the South for a Congressional Slave•code to protect Slavery in the Territories and in the States; and it attempts to sustain this demsna by same of the meet remarkable admisSions which have ever found their way into a South ern newspaper. Tho Enquirer declares that io all the northern ,counties of Virginia, Slavery has already beep virtually abolished by the mere railorest the General Government to afford adequate firoleet- Gen to the ineltlulioa. " N00.1111eiVelali00.", says ibis leading organ, "has practically !ibex.. sled the slaves of one entire tier of counties in Virginia." The principle of non-intervention by ; the Federal Government, it adds, is "prac• tiaally abolitionizing Virginia, and gradually but purely uuderruitag Iho Inelltnlion," Pro. The Enquirer ehould select some more arpropri atelime for iodulglng in threats against the North, than the morrow of the day on which twenty eraoh-braleed Northern fanatics cap. lured a Virginia village of two thousand inhabi tants, cowering, in the language of their own Govirner, like sheeplitefore them. If Virginia cannot protect herself against ouch an invasion as that of Brown, except by the intervention of Federal troops, she is scar c ely in condition to reject all aid from the Federal Government, dis eotee the Union and defy the whole power of the Northcru Statea. The flarpree Ferry af fair ehonld teach the 'States the extent of her dependence upon the Federal arm. Tee Con. etitution of the United States has roused ninety , niee.hundrothe of the people of the Free States to prompt and indignant reprobation of thie ne farious attempt to Invade the South—and a yin gift company of Federal troops crushed 'be movement and saved the State militia a long and possibly a doubtful struggle. This is scarcely the time for pushing.uureasonable demands on ,the Northern States, under threats of abandon iug them to destruction mud doorair. The South has a right to ask ham the S 'rib and from the Federal Government absolute non- interveatiou with Slavery, except 111 coney of re bellion ut ineurreetioo, when the whole power of the 1,411.,0 is pledged to its atipprubzi,u Tin. bliguttou the North nod the eouutry ern rew.ly a wept to its fullest extent. nut evert the: wil- liogoers will be put id some jeopardy If it le made the beats of snob claims as the Enquirer now pate forward. 01 one thing it may root assured: the Federal Government will never aokowledge Itself to be the protector and open nor of Slavery in the Southern Stolen. lie whole duty is performed when it kilt Slavery alone. Even the Supreme Court and Ridge Sleek-ton= in_ the opteion that Slavery to the creature of local law, and that wherever that local law operates the Federal Government has no right to Interfere. If the South will evince a coneervativa and rational disposition on this euhject, the National Goverment will readily asecot to this theory, and will abstain from any interference with Southern Slavery. But the demand for Federal protection for Slavery will provoke on opposite demand for its extinctiJt., and the construction of the Constitution which ie relied on to sustain the one will give plausibilitrand force to the other. If under the system of federal nen.interven, alum Virginia is becoming free, that result must be regarded as beyond the reach of a remedy. Tho Clovernment cannot convert itself into an Inatirance Company againet the operation' of natural lawe. And the Engetissr will beet coo out the intereeteof the South, as well as of the country at large, by abstaining from thee press en unjust acid Inadmiseable °hams upon the Federal power.—N. Y. Times. Tot SMOICCICS CASCIII —ilia remarkable re• searah made by M. Bouisson, upon the danger of smoking, has attracted the - notice of the Ac• edema° -Francaise, and has been rewarded with high praise. 6 The horrors hitherto -unknown, or unacknowledged, with which smoker/ are threat ened, nay - more, -- oansioted by M. Ilonieeon, are sufficient upon bare anticipation to rein the-rev enue and the pipe-makers also. ;Cancer in the mouth M. Douireon declares to/are grown so frequent from the not of tobitooo that it now forme one of the most dreaded diseattes in the hospitals, end at Montpelier, where M. Bouisson resides, the operation of its extraction forme the princi pal practice of the eurgeone there. In a short period of time, from 1945 to 1859, M. Boras son himself performed sixty-eight operations for cancer in the lips at the Hospital Saint Eloi. The writers, on cancer previous to our day, mention the rare occurrence of the disease in the lips, and it has therefore become evident that it must have inoreaced of late years in pro port ion with- the smoking of tobacco. ht. Boni-- eon proves this fact by the relative increase in the French deities on tobacoo, which, in 1812, brought en annual amount of`2s millions, and now give a revenue of 180 millione; almost that attained by duties on. wines and spirits,. and far beyond that rendered by those en auger. '4ll. Bonisson remarks, justly or not, that "this figitro extravigant as it may appear, fades into toe* nifraince - before that attained by the British tax, which, according to Dr. Seymour, amounts to a fabulous sum, in a country where boys smoke from flee o'olook in the afternoon till three o'clock in the morning and where children of ten years old are known to consume as many as forty cigars In a day." The nee of tobacco rarely,however,produces by cancer In youth. Almost all Bouieson'e patieota had passed the age of forty. In iodividuals of the bumbler els:sees, who smoke ebort pipe and tobacco of Inferior quality, the diocese, is more frequent than with the rich, who smoke cigars or long pipes. it becomes evident, there fore, that it is °win more to the constant eppli. cation 'of heat to the lips, than to the inhaling of the nicotine, that the theme is generated. With the Orientals, who are careful to maintain the coolness of the mouthpiece by the trantuninaini OfAho smoke through perfumed water, the dla• ell;_e is unkoown.
